Unlike traditional LSPosed installations that exist as a separate application in your app drawer, a parasitic installation acts as an extension of an existing application—usually the . This method allows the LSPosed manager to run seamlessly without needing its own independent launcher icon, making it stealthier and often more deeply integrated into the system.
